Unit Plan Summary:Students demonstrate critical thinking by discovering the interconnectedness between water quality, dam placement, mining and salmon habitat. Using technology in the field, and real time data from the internet, they will be asked to determine if the critical resource of water will be safe and sufficient to support the predicted population in the Coast Fork Willamette watershed. Working as self-directed learners, students move from the water cycle to calculating the usage of the City and the rural populations.

Essential Question

Will your grandkids go thirsty in our watershed?

Page 4: Al Kennedy  Alternative High School

Unit QuestionsHow does it get here?How much water do we use now? Will we use?Is our water source safe?How have European Americans impacted the local water?

Page 5: Al Kennedy  Alternative High School

What is the water cycle for Cottage Grove? What watershed do we live in and what does it look like?Do our hills help collect water? (inquiry)How much water does CG use?How many water rights are in effect outside of CG within our watershed?What is the projected population growth for CFW watershed?How is water quality tested?What is our water quality index?Are we in violation of the Clean Water Act?What macro invertebrates do we have locally? What have European Americans done to the water supply?

Extensions: Model stream flow gradient model impact on erosionWhat is our water used for? crops/irrigation? Water usage? Camping usage?Are our wetlands growing or diminishing? Can we repair wetland/riparian?Provide samples of improvements to CCR (content/graphics)Can the town of CG flood again? Where?

Benefits of Using Project Approaches, Ongoing Assessment, and CFQs in My Unit

• Students collaborate with peers to collect data (using technology) to understand the health of their watershed.

• Students look at real time data to gain a historical perspective of local water volumes.

• Students will improve writing and thinking skills through peer assessment and reflection.

• Public publishing on the school’s website of the answer to the essential question will improve the quality of student work.
